Following implantation, it takes a day or so for enough hCG to accumulate to turn a test positive. Implantation most typically occurs between 8-10 Days Past Ovulation, which is why 10 or 11DPO can be a time when pregnant folks who closely track ovulation begin to notice positives. Like. k. kaitlin11m. Jan 10, 2021 at 1:05 PM. 11DPO very faint.It's actually common to get a negative pregnancy test at 9 DPO and go on to get a positive test a few days later. In an analysis of over 93,000 menstrual cycles, the fertility tracking app Fertility Friend found that fewer than 10% of pregnancy charts showed a positive at 9 DPO. While 13 DPO might be a little bit early to do an at-home urine pregnancy test, you might be able to tell if you’re pregnant at 13 DPO using a blood test. This is because blood tests are slightly more sensitive than urine tests and can detect very small levels of hCG very early on in pregnancy, sometimes as early as 7 to 10 DPO. It’s best ...

Additionally, testing too early can sometimes result in false positives due to ...The more important number is how many days it's been since you ovulated. Only a few percent of pregnant people see a positive at 8 dpo. At around 12 dpo, most people will test positive. By 14 dpo, the result is pretty definitive. You can do a pregnancy test at any time. However, 10 DPO is still very early to detect a positive pregnancy. According to research, implantation occurs between 8 to 10 DPO in most women (84%) but can happen between 6 to 12 days after ovulation.
